Israeli intelligence burnt West Bank family

Days of Palestine, Jerusalem –Investigations found that Israeli intelligence agent had burnt Palestinian family in West Bank city of Nablus three months ago.

Credible sources said Shin Bet -Israeli intelligence services- had arrested right wing Elisha Odess, 17, and Hanoch Ganiram putting them under administrative detention on suspicion of carrying out crimes against Palestinians.

Though a gag order has been imposed on the two suspects, Israeli website Tikun Olam revealed that while they were interrogated the names of two other suspects were revealed and they were arrested.

The site said the last name of the second suspect is still unknown, adding that both are accused of arson in the attack against the home of the Dawabsheh family.

The attack, which took place in July, resulted in the death of a young couple and their one-year-old son. The couple’s other son is still undergoing treatment in the intensive care unit of an Israeli hospital.

According to the credible sources, Shin Bet planted its agents within settlement youths and now refuses to charge the suspects or release them, fearing the identity of their sources may be revealed.

Ganiram is the grandson of Yitzhak Ganiram, who targeted several Palestinian officials in the 1980s. He has previously been arrested and released on bail.
